    Situated within the Defence Research & Development Organisation under the Ministry of Defence, the Office of DG(ACE) issues tenders primarily through the government’s eProcurement portals (e.g., eProcure.gov.in, Defence Procurement portals).

    Tenders may include supply of specialised equipment (for example, industrial switches or layer-2 access switches) as well as service/works contracts such as maintenance, civil/structural works and outsourcing of manpower. Indian vendors must meet defence procurement norms, which generally include registration, experience, compliance with “Make in India” norms (where applicable), bid security/EMD, and timely online submission.

    Key procurement categories you should filter for:

    1. Supply of equipment & components: e.g., industrial switches, fibre patch panels, specialised defence hardware.

    2. Civil/structural works and maintenance: For example, partition works at DG(ACE) offices, term contracts for building works, property maintenance.

    3. Service contracts / manpower outsourcing: Outsourcing of manpower for technical / non-technical roles at DRDO estates.

    4. Facility & estate management: Maintenance of buildings, surveillance systems, fire-safety equipment under estate-management units.

    Tracking these categories can help your firm pick tenders aligned with your capability and scale.

    Here is a practical step-by-step guide for Indian vendors participating in DG(ACE) tenders:

    1. Register your firm on relevant eProcurement portals (e.g., the central eProcurement System, Ministry of Defence portals). Ensure you have PAN, GST, MSME certificate (if applicable), D&B or other required credentials.

    2. Monitor tender listings: Use proper filters for “Office of DG(ACE)” or DRDO/Ministry of Defence in portals. Set alerts for supply/works/service categories relevant to you.

    3. Download the tender documents: Read the NIT (Notice Inviting Tender), BOQ, specification, eligibility criteria, EMD or bid security details, submission timelines.

    4. Prepare your bid:

    4.1. Technical bid: company profile, previous experience (especially in defence/industrial sector), required certifications, compliance with “Make in India” or other special conditions.

    4.2. Financial bid: pricing schedule, taxes, required formats (often involves two‐cover system: technical and price).

    5. Submit online before deadline: Upload required documents as per the portal’s instructions. Late submissions are generally rejected.

    6. Post submission: Monitor bid opening, technical evaluation and financial bid opening. Some tenders also involve bank guarantee, contract performance guarantee, or execution timelines.

    7. After award: If successful, sign contract, mobilise resources, execute per schedule, and invoice per payment terms.

    Tenders of DG(ACE) are listed on portals such as the Central eProcurement System (eProcure.gov.in) and Defence Procurement portals under the Ministry of Defence.

    These portals allow search by organisation, tender type, closing date, state etc. Vendors should bookmark the pages, use filters for “Office of DG(ACE)”, and enable alerts for new postings to avoid missing deadlines. The portal will typically list reference number, publication date, closing date, number of covers, evaluation type and procurement category.

    1. What types of tenders does the Office of DG(ACE) issue?

    The office issues tenders for supply of specialised equipment and components, civil works, estate management services, manpower outsourcing, and infrastructure maintenance contracts.

    2. Where can I find DG(ACE) tenders?

    On portals like the Central eProcurement System (eProcure.gov.in), Defence eProcurement portals under the Ministry of Defence, and third-party tender listing platforms filtering for “Office of DG(ACE)”.

    3. Do MSMEs get a preference in DG(ACE) tenders?

    MSMEs may receive preference under government procurement policy, but defence procurement guidelines may include additional conditions related to technical capability or “Make in India” compliance. Always verify the specific tender/NIT clauses.

    4. What is an EMD or bid-security in these tenders?

    Many tenders require an Earnest Money Deposit (EMD) or Bank Guarantee to ensure seriousness and commitment of bidders. For example, one DG(ACE) tender required an EMD of ₹60,60.

    5. What is the typical evaluation process?

    The technical bid is evaluated first for eligibility and compliance. Financial bids of only technically qualified bidders are opened, and the award decision is then taken based on evaluation rules.

    6. Can foreign firms participate?

    Participation depends on tender-specific conditions. Many defence tenders restrict participation to Indian entities or mandate minimum local content under “Make in India”. Check the NIT carefully before applying.

    7. What happens after I win a DG(ACE) contract?

    You sign a formal contract, may need to provide a Performance Bank Guarantee, mobilise manpower/materials, execute the project as per schedule, and raise invoices for payment as per contract terms.

    8. How long do these contracts typically last?

    Project duration varies—supply orders may complete in a few months, while service and manpower outsourcing contracts often run 6-12 months or longer, depending on requirements. For instance, a manpower contract recently spanned 6 months.

    9. What if I miss the submission deadline?

    Late bids are generally rejected automatically by the eProcurement system. It is essential to prepare documents early and submit well before the cutoff time.
